Weight Answer 1

1. The surface gravity of Mars is 3·7 N/kg. On Earth it is 9·8 N/kg. Beagle 2, the unsuccessful British space probe, had a mass of 30 kg.

Calculate the weight of Beagle 2:

  1. on the Earth before launch.
    W = m × g = 30 × 9·8 = 294 N
  2. on the surface of Mars.
    W = m × g = 30 × 3·7 = 111 N
